The most common legal options for obtaining compensation are making a claim or seeking financial aid through asbestos trusts. Asbestos sufferers can file a mesothelioma claim suit against the producers of asbestos containing products who were responsible for their exposure. These companies knew asbestos was a risk but they employed it to make money. These asbestos companies can be sued by victims of mesothelioma, who can claim millions of dollars in compensation.

Compensation for mesothelioma cases could include past and future medical expenses as well as lost earnings, emotional distress and physical pain. Asbestos-related victims could also be qualified for compensation through asbestos trusts. These trusts are funded by bankruptcy trusts and currently hold assets worth more than $30 billion.
